Administrative history
Lady Eaton College was opened in 1969 on the Symons Campus of Trent University. Principals have been Marjory Seeley Rogers, Douglas McCalla, Dale Standen, David Page, John Stanford, Paul Zeleza, Rosa Garrido, Kenneth Field, Arnt Kruger, etc. For further information about the College and its administration, see A.O.C. Cole, Trent: The Making of a University, pp. 126-129; D'Arcy Jenish, Trent University: Celebrating 50 Years of Excellence, 2014; and the annual course calendars (available in the Archives Reading Room).
